Output 16ab3f0303d6084e28fda15014598bfa2230612ec0dc9536f0ce41abf71a7962:1

value
900658615
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 46386d45166cd9f35fb720332d125efae884794d OP_EQUALVERIFY OP_CHECKSIG
address
17QHu2wKZ5orNb4t6JBapu2YzjnGqtarYy
transaction
16ab3f0303d6084e28fda15014598bfa2230612ec0dc9536f0ce41abf71a7962
spent
true